Finding the right fit
Not every student knows exactly what they want to study, and that’s okay.
College is a time for discovery, growth, and finding new passions. As you support your student through the college search process, look for schools that offer a wide range of programs and encourage early exploration. Keep in mind that academic interests often evolve — sometimes slightly, sometimes dramatically — as students gain new experiences and insights.

Let’s get acquainted — take a college tour
Seeing is believing — especially when it comes to finding the best fit for college.
As your student begins narrowing down their list of schools, campus visits can be one of the most valuable steps in the decision-making process. While visiting in person provides an unmatched, immersive experience, many colleges also offer virtual tours, interactive maps, and videos of campus life to give families a feel for the community from home. Using these digital resources before coming to campus can help your student get a sense of what feels right and make the most of any in-person visits that follow.
